Practical Tips
- Maintain a shallow depth of field (like f/2.8) to keep the subject sharp while blurring the background. This draws attention to the subject.
- Use natural lighting whenever possible for a more authentic look. Avoid overly bright flashes that can create harsh shadows.
- Incorporate personal elements in the environment to tell a story, like unique cockpit features or personal items.
Common mistakes include using too much contrast or overly saturated colors, which can detract from the realism. Instead, aim for balanced tones to enhance the photorealistic quality.
For different creative goals, consider varying the mood by changing the lighting conditions—perhaps a sunset for a warmer, more dramatic look, or a cloudy day for a moody atmosphere. These adjustments can significantly alter the image's impact.
